The mighty Kreator recently announced that their fifteenth studio album, Hate Über Alles, will be released on June 3. Five years after their highly acclaimed album Gods Of Violence, peaking at #1 in the German album charts, the genre-defining band are proud to present this 11-track behemoth. Today, the band releases the second single and video, for the track "Strongest Of The Strong".

Starchaser, a new band formed by former Tad Morose guitarist Kenneth Jonsson, recently announced the upcoming release of their self-titled debut album on May 6.
Today, fans can get a taste of new music from the band with the release of the lyric video for "Starchaser".

UXB Press has uploaded the video below, featuring Motörhead's performances on British television, which aired between 1979 and 1981.
Watch the band perform "Bomber", "Leaving Here", "Ace Of Spades", and "Please Don't Touch"

Hypocricy has parted ways with drummer Reidar "Horgh" Horghagen, who drummed for the band between 2004 and 2022. According to both his and Hypocricy's statements, the split was amicable. No replacement has yet been announced for Horghagen.
